• # Un seul ?

    Posté par (page perso) . Évalué à 2.

    - scp + shell
    - cfengine
    - puppet
    - ...

    Par contre "gestionnaire web de cron" je crois que tu vas devoir l'écrire toi-même, pour la simple raison que si c'est un gestionnaire web, c'est plutôt destiné aux personnes ayant des connaissances limitées à propos de cron, des systèmes et autres, donc ton gestionnaire devra obligatoirement être adapté à ton besoin précis (par exemple lancer des commandes non modifiables à des heures modifiables). Aucun produit ne peut deviner ton usage.
    • [^] # Re: Un seul ?

      Posté par . Évalué à 1.

      scp + shell , euh tu crois que je serai venu sur un forum pour utiliser shell + scp ? pour un environnement multi serveur .... merci de ta réponse quand même.

      http://www.orsyp.com/fr/products/unijob.asp

      je cherche un equivalent gratuit/libre
      • [^] # Re: Un seul ?

        Posté par (page perso) . Évalué à 1.

        Ça reviens au même...

        Tout ce que tu as a faire est de configurer ton cron pour faire s'exécuter sur tes serveurs via scp + ssh exec tout les X tes fichiers.

        Puis tu crée un interface web qui va générer ces fichier de script.

        Après tout dépend de tes besoins...

        ps : les clés publiques/privée sans mdp sont tes amis ainsi que sudo pour l'exécution root des scripts...
        • [^] # Re: Un seul ?

          Posté par . Évalué à 1.

          ben pas trop non.

          je géré deja mes serveur svia ssh , clef public (pas root bien sure) echangée etc ..


          le but c'est de visualiser en UN écran les job qui vont tourner de nuit ou la journée ET pouvoir en rajouter sur n'importe quel serveur, au besoin on depose le fichier avec les bon droits sur le serveur.

          unijob en somme.

          je pense le developper mes je sais pas trop en quoi.

          ajax, php , j2ee ... gtk + .. enfin bref bcp de question ... ;-)
          • [^] # Re: Un seul ?

            Posté par (page perso) . Évalué à 2.

            Lorsque j'était môme, j'utilisais bêtement les outils par défauts, fiables, robustes, simples. Ca prend une ligne de shell pour traiter ça:

            serveur1 0 1 * * 2-7 root ta_commande1
            serveur1 0 5 * * * root ta_commande2
            serveur2 30 10 * * * backup ta_commande3

            Maintenant que je suis grand, je sais que cette manière de faire est trop sujette à erreurs alors j'utilise des fichiers séparés (un peu plus de 40 serveurs actuellement).
            • [^] # Re: Un seul ?

              Posté par . Évalué à 0.

              et tu arrives a savoir si tes jobs se sont déroulés correctement en une seule page ?
              et tu peux deployer tes cron en fonction des users sur tout tes serveurs ?

              peux tu voir une une seule page quel batch passe avant tel autre et les liens entre eux ?

              si oui j'aimerai bien que tu partage ton savoir, cela m'intéresse grandement ....
              • [^] # Re: Un seul ?

                Posté par (page perso) . Évalué à 2.

                tu arrives a savoir si tes jobs se sont déroulés correctement en une seule page ?
                La demande porte sur cron, et cron n'est pas fait pour remonter les infos.


                tu peux deployer tes cron en fonction des users sur tout tes serveurs ?
                Je ne saisi pas le problème.


                peux tu voir une une seule page quel batch passe avant tel autre et les liens entre eux ?
                Si tu n'est pas en mesure de lire un fichier texte "dans l'ordre", effectivement c'est ennuyeux :-)
      • [^] # tentakel ou webmin

        Posté par . Évalué à 1.

        tentakel est vraiment pratique pour exécuter une commande sur un ensemble de serveurs par ssh :
        http://www.cyberciti.biz/tips/execute-commands-on-multiple-l(...)

        Si tu préfères réellement un environnement graphique, il semble que webmin soit capable de gérer les cron d'un ensemble de serveurs.
        Après je ne sais pas s'il permet de propager une même cron de partout, ou les gérer individuellement.
  • # that's it

    Posté par . Évalué à 1.

    je me réponds à moi même.


    il existe un outil bien fumant : spaceWalk (release libre du redhat satellite, ça à l'air dédpoter sévère ...affaire à suivre donc)
  • # autres outils

    Posté par . Évalué à 1.

    - ortro
    - quartz (mais j2ee et framework a connaitre)
  • # un autre ...

    Posté par . Évalué à 1.

    sourceforge : job scheduler (bien documenté)
  • # definitivement : on test grandeur nature

    Posté par . Évalué à 1.

    ORTRO :

    vraiment superbe cet outil , je recommande

Suivre le flux des commentaires

Note : les commentaires appartiennent à ceux qui les ont postés. Nous n'en sommes pas responsables.